> FS can store the information on the registered users in a database through
> odbc.
> http:// wiki.freeswitch.org/wiki/Using_ODBC_in_the_core
>
> Thus, we can not use sofia_contact for definition the user is registered or
> not. Instead of sofia_contact we do simple check in our database of an
> operating script.
>
> Such method is especially useful at work of several FS with a share
> database.
>
> If you use sofia_contact, check the user is registered or not occurs
> particularly on it FS.
> If check occurs in a shared database, we receive the information on that
> the user on one of our several FS is registered

> Or mod_xml_cdr. But regardless of the method, you'll still want to use
> sofia_contact at least to see if the user is currently registered.
>
> There'll probably be lower overhead to static XML if you don't need your
> dialplan generated dynamically.
>
> It doesn't matter what method is used to serve the user directory -
> user_exists and sofia_contact will work with them all.

> Does user exist in user directory?
> http://wiki.freeswitch.org/wiki/Mod_commands#user_exists
>
> Is the user registered?
> http://wiki.freeswitch.org/wiki/Function_sofia_contact
>
> Quick example (untested but would probably work):
>
> <!-- If the user doesn't exist, reject the call -->
> <extension name="user_not_found">
>   <condition field="${user_exists(id ${destination_number} $${domain})}"
> expression="false">
>     <action application="hangup" data="*UNALLOCATED_NUMBER*" />
>   </condition>
> </extension>
> <!-- If the user is registered, forward the call to them -->
> <extension name="user_registered">
>   <condition field="${sofia_contact(profile/${destination_number}@$${domain})}"
> expression="(.+)">
>     <action application="set" data="hangup_on_bridge=true" />
>     <action application="bridge" data="$1" />
>   </condition>
> </extension>
> <!-- If the bridge fails, or the user wasn't registered, fall back to
> voicemail -->
> <extension name="voicemail">
>   <condition field="destination_number" expression=".*">
>     <action application="voicemail" data="profile $${domain}
> ${destination_number}" />
>   </condition>
> </extension>

>     I have a set of local users registered to freeswitch. So, when user
> is not registered with switch I get USER_NOT_REGISTERED when route call
> to it. But is there a way to know is user present in directory and not
> registered, or even isn't in directory? I want to call voicemail in
> first case and play 'invalid number' message in second. Is this possible?
